- Basement foundation repair - needed when basement walls show signs of cracking or bowing due to shifting soil or moisture issues.
- Slab foundation repair - required if uneven floors or cracks in the concrete slab emerge, indicating settling or movement.
- Pier and beam foundation repair - necessary when floors sag or become uneven, often caused by wood rot or soil erosion beneath the structure.
- Crawl space foundation repair - essential if moisture problems, mold, or pest infestations are present in the crawl area.
- Foundation leveling services - sought when the building's foundation has settled unevenly, leading to structural imbalances.

Problems that building foundation repair services help resolve often stem from soil movement, poor drainage, or construction issues. These issues can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and in severe cases, structural failure. Addressing these problems early can prevent more costly repairs or safety hazards in the future. Professional foundation repair services aim to stabilize the affected areas, correct existing damage, and reinforce the foundation to withstand ongoing stresses, ultimately safeguarding the property's value and safety.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. Smaller repairs, such as crack injections, may cost around $1,000 to $3,000, while major underpinning can exceed $10,000.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s vary based on soil conditions, foundation type, and the size of the affected area. For example, repairing a basement foundation in Columbia Station might fall within the $3,000 to $8,000 range for common issues.
Average Service Expenses - On average, homeowners can expect to pay between $4,000 and $9,000 for comprehensive foundation stabilization and repair services. Prices tend to increase with the complexity of the repair project.
Additional Cost Considerations - Extra expenses may include excavation, hydraulic piers, or wall reinforcement, which can add several thousand dollars to the total. Local pros provide estimates tailored to specific foundation issues and property con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a building foundation needs repair?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or door jambs.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to my property? Repair processes may involve some disturbance, such as minor excavation or access to basement areas, but experienced contractors aim to minimize impact on the property.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Services may include slabjacking, pier and beam repairs, underpinning, and stabilization to address various foundation issues.
